Walker, Susan & Andrew Burnett
THE IMAGE OF AUGUSTUS
Faint yellowing to rear wraps. ; Few rulers have surpassed the first Roman Emperor Augustus in the use of visual propaganda. The images he chose for his portraits, and the designs stamped on his coins or carved on his public monuments, were skilfully chosen to cloak the reality of his power by setting the benefits of his autocracy against a Republican façade. This book introduces the historical background to Augustan portraiture and illustrates the development of the emperor's public image from the beginning of his career in 44 BC to the posthumous portraits which likened him to a god. Includes images of coins of Alexander the Great, Seleucus, Julius Caesar and others. ; 47 pages

Walker, Susan & Peter Higgs (Eds. )
CLEOPATRA OF EGYPT From History to Myth
Light edgewear to wraps. Spine a bit creased. ; This lavishly illustrated catalogue coincides with a major international exhibition celebrating images of Cleopatra. It explores how she was depicted during her own era, in works ranging from coins to life-size sculpture. Exciting new discoveries are featured--including seven Egyptian-style statues believed to represent Cleopatra, and two portraits probably commissioned while she was living in Rome with Julius Caesar. The book also examines interpretations of Cleopatra from the Renaissance to modern times, as seen in paintings, ceramics, jewelry, plays, operas, and film. In addition, recent archaeological finds from Alexandria (Cleopatra's capital) and from Rome illustrate aspects of life in Cleopatra's day. ; 4to - over 9¾" - 12" tall; 384 pages

Wallace-Hadrill, Andrew
SUETONIUS The Scholar and His Caesars
Ex-library copy with usual stamps and traces of removed pocket (to ffep). No call numbers to spine. ; Seutonius, a Roman historian, was the author of "The Lives of the Caesars". This biography sets the historian's career and his method of dealing with his subject matter in the context of Roman society in the early Empire, and draws a picture of the coherence of Suetonius's life, appointments, scholarship and literary activities. Seutonius is presented as a man of learning, rather than as a failed narrative historian. This portrait takes account of evidence concerning his life and seeks to clarify the character of "The Lives of the Caesars" as a description of emperors and Roman imperial society by a scholarly biographer who himself was in the service of a scholarly Caesar; Classical Life and Letters; 216 pages

Ward Perkins Bryan
La caduta di Roma e la fine della civiltà
ill., br. Roma non è caduta. O almeno cosi dicono le più recenti teorie storiografiche. La transizione al dominio germanico sarebbe stata graduale e pacifica, risultato di una progressiva integrazione delle popolazioni del nord, vitali ma primitive, nel grande organismo imperiale, raffinato e ormai prossimo all'esaurimento. II loro mescolarsi avrebbe dato vita a una nuova era di positive trasformazioni culturali. Niente affatto, sostiene Bryan Ward-Perkins. Ma quale integrazione, quale proficua sistemazione delle popolazioni esterne entro i confini dell'impero! "I Germani che invasero l'impero d'Occidente occuparono o estorsero con la minaccia della forza la massima parte dei territori in cui si stabilirono, senza alcun accordo formale sulla divisione delle risorse con i loro nuovi sudditi romani. Dovunque si abbiano testimonianze di una certa ampiezza, la norma era indubbiamente la conquista o la resa alla minaccia della forza, e non un accordo pacifico".
